She was the wife of Phillip Isley and the dau of Henry Oldfather and Catharine Ziegler. Mary Magdalena gave birth to 11 children. She was born in Somerset Co, Pa and died near Edinburg, IN. After Phillip died, Mary Magdalena moved in to the home of her son that was just a stone's throw away from St. George Church and Cemetery. Her husband is buried as is described in the gravestone photo. The possibility of exhuming his remains and moving them to St. George Cemetery, so that he could be buried next to or near Mary Magdalena, was discussed at a John Isley reunion in the late 1970's. However, it was decided that such was not feasible.
